Portuguese

Etymology

Calque of English New England.

Pronunciation

 
  • (Brazil) IPA(key): /ˈnɔ.vɐ 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.ʁɐ/ [ˈnɔ.vɐ 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.hɐ]
    • (Rio de Janeiro) IPA(key): /ˈnɔ.vɐ 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.ʁɐ/ [ˈnɔ.vɐ 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.χɐ]
    • (Southern Brazil) IPA(key): /ˈnɔ.va 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.ʁa/ [ˈnɔ.va ĩ.ɡlaˈtɛ.ha]
 
  • (Portugal) IPA(key): /ˈnɔ.vɐ ĩ.ɡlɐˈtɛ.ʁɐ/
    • (Northern Portugal) IPA(key): /ˈnɔ.bɐ ĩ.ɡlɐˈtɛ.ʁɐ/ [ˈnɔ.βɐ ĩ.ɡlɐˈtɛ.ʁɐ]

Proper noun

Nova Inglaterra f

  1. New England (a geographic region of the northeastern United States, consisting of Connecticut, Maine, Massachusetts, New Hampshire, Rhode Island and Vermont)
